Are the S19 S19 Yet Worth in this year?

The question of whether the Miner S19 is remaining beneficial in 2024 presents a difficult situation. While it was once a top unit for Bitcoin mining, its power and electricity consumption must be closely considered today. Newer, more cost-effective miners have entered the market, often offering significantly better results per watt. Therefore, unless you’ve secured exceptionally affordable electricity or are running it in a region with highly positive mining regulations, a brand new S19 might not be the most lucrative investment. However, used units can still offer some value if priced appropriately, especially for miners looking to gradually expand their operations or those with existing infrastructure.

Maximize Hashrate: The Power of ASIC Miners Like the S19

To gain peak mining power, many crypto enthusiasts turn to specialized hardware like Application-Specific Integrated Circuits, or ASICs. The Bitmain Antminer S19 is a popular example, designed specifically for Bitcoin mining and offering substantially higher efficiency than general-purpose CPUs or GPUs. These machines provide significantly more hashes per watt, allowing you to boost your network contribution and potential rewards – though they also require considerable electricity consumption and a significant initial investment. Careful consideration of power costs and cooling solutions is crucial when deploying an S19 or similar ASIC for profitable Bitcoin generation.
